The working principle of the sliding door device
The translational door device is a device that is driven by a motor, so that the door leaf carries out translational movement along the track perpendicular to the ground, which is mainly composed of motor, track, control system and other parts, when the motor receives the instruction to open or close, it will generate power, drive the door leaf to slide on the track, realize the opening and closing of the door.

Features of the sliding door device:
1. Energy saving and environmental protection: The sliding door device is driven by a motor, which has the advantage of energy saving, and the noise is less during operation, which meets the requirements of environmental protection.
2. Small space occupation: Because the sliding door device adopts translational mode switching, it occupies less space than the traditional revolving door, and is suitable for places with limited space.
3. High safety: The sliding door device is equipped with safety sensors and control systems, and when it encounters obstacles, it will automatically stop running to avoid safety accidents such as pinching.
4. Good stability: the sliding door device runs smoothly and is not easy to shake, swing and other phenomena, which improves the stability of use.
5. Wide range of application: The sliding door device is suitable for various places, such as residences, shopping malls, hospitals, airports, etc.

Application of sliding door device
1. Residential: The sliding door device is widely used in the bedroom, study and other private spaces of the residence, which occupies a small space and has the characteristics of high security, providing users with a convenient experience.
2. Shopping malls: Sliding door devices are often used at the entrances and exits of shopping malls to facilitate customers to enter and exit, and at the same time improve the overall image of shopping malls.
3. Hospitals: For doors that need to be opened and closed frequently, such as emergency rooms and operating rooms, the use of sliding door devices can improve work efficiency and reduce the risk of cross-infection.
4. Airport: The terminal, boarding gate and other places of the airport adopt sliding door devices, which can ensure the rapid passage of passengers and improve the operational efficiency of the airport.
